Preamble

K.L.E. Society’s P. C. Jabin Science College, Hubballi is committed to a fair, transparent, ethical, compassionate, equitable and consistent admission process.  The admission policy is in tune with aspirations of saptarshis which endeavors to provide quality education for north Karnataka youth with values and social commitment.  Admission shall be open to all aspirant youngsters regardless of caste, creed, religion, language background, geographic location, or communal status.

Scope

This policy and guidelines apply to prospective applicants seeking admission as well as stakeholders participating in the admission process.

Admission Committee

The management shall constitute an Admission committee consisting of Principal, Faculty members from various departments, Administrative staff every year.  The committee is responsible for executing the Admission Policy and Guidelines.

Roles and Responsibilities

The Admission Committee has the following roles and responsibilities:

    • Define and modify the admission policy and guidelines in line with the parent society and University. 
    • Identify and adhere to the government norms of admissions.
    • Schedule of admission (date, time and venue).
    • Media Management/Printing of required Brochures and other materials.

Eligibility

A candidate who has passed two-year Pre-University Course (PUC) Examination conducted by Pre-University Education Board, Government of Karnataka, or 10+2 Examination conducted by CBSE or equivalent examinations by any Other State or any other recognized Board / Department shall be eligible for admission to First Semester U.G. Programme.

    1. For B.Sc. Programmes, a candidate who has passed PUC / 10+2 with Science or Diploma in Paramedical Courses (not less than 2-year duration) shall be eligible for admission.
      • A candidate opting life science subjects like Botany, Zoology, Biotechnology, Genetics, Microbiology, etc., as DSCC in the B.Sc. Programme must have studied Physics, Chemistry and Biology as prerequisite subjects at the qualifying examination.
      • A candidate opting subjects like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ics as DSCC must have studied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ics as prerequisite subjects at the qualifying examination.
      • A candidate opting Statistics as DSCC for B.Sc. degree must have studied Statistics or Mathematics as prerequisite subject at the qualifying examination.
      • A student of Diploma in Paramedical Course is eligible for Chemistry and any other Life Science subjects as DSCC.
    2. For B.C.A. Programme, a candidate with PUC/ 10+2 Science or Commerce with Mathematics / Business Mathematics / Accountancy / Computer Science or 3 -year Diploma with Computer Science / Information Science or 2-year JOC / ITI with Computer Science, shall be eligible.
    3. For Post graduation programmes, a candidate who has passed the qualifying degree examination from a recognized University with 60% marks shall be eligible to apply for postgraduate programmes. 

Admission Procedure

An exclusive and functional office shall be responsible for executing the admission process of the institution. The office shall decide the admission criteria, norms and process for each programme, every academic year.

Pre-admission process

  • Preparation of the tentative calendar for counseling in various programmes.
  • Updating of programme details and fee structure in the website.
  • Preparation of prospectus, posters and brochures.
  •  Advertisement in news papers and social media.
  • Notification of admission dates of various programmes.
  • Setting up of help desk to give details about the programmes, eligibility criteria, and admission requirements and other supporting facilities. 

Admission requirements

Any candidate seeking admission to a course shall be asked to submit the following attested documents along with the application form.

  • Class XII Statement of Marks/Degree Marks Card.
  • SSLC Marks Card or equivalent certificate issued by the competent authority.
  • Income and Caste Certificate (wherever applicable)
  • Migration Certificate (wherever applicable)
  • Eligibility Certificate (wherever applicable)
  • Aadhar Card.
  • Two Passport size Photos
  • Undertaking form.
